Material Science Behind Stainless Steel Durability

Corrosion Resistance Properties

The fundamental reason why a stainless steel straight hair brush demonstrates exceptional durability lies in the material's inherent resistance to corrosion and oxidation. Stainless steel contains chromium, typically comprising 10.5% or more of the alloy composition, which forms a protective oxide layer on the surface when exposed to oxygen. This invisible barrier prevents rust formation and protects the underlying metal from environmental factors that would otherwise cause degradation in other materials.

Unlike iron-based materials that rust when exposed to moisture, or aluminum that can corrode over time, stainless steel maintains its structural integrity even in humid bathroom environments. This corrosion resistance ensures that the bristles and framework of a stainless steel straight hair brush remain strong and functional, preventing the weakening that leads to bristle loss or structural failure in lesser materials.

Mechanical Strength Characteristics

The mechanical properties of stainless steel contribute significantly to the durability of hair brushes constructed from this material. With a tensile strength ranging from 515 to 827 MPa depending on the specific grade used, stainless steel provides exceptional resistance to bending, breaking, or deformation under normal styling forces. This strength allows manufacturers to create thinner, more precise bristle configurations without sacrificing durability.

The high yield strength of stainless steel means that a stainless steel straight hair brush can withstand repeated flexing during use without experiencing permanent deformation. This property is particularly important for maintaining consistent bristle spacing and alignment, which directly affects the brush's ability to deliver smooth, even styling results over extended periods of use.

Resistance to Environmental Factors

Heat Tolerance and Thermal Stability

Professional hair styling often involves exposure to elevated temperatures from blow dryers, flat irons, and other heat styling tools. A stainless steel straight hair brush demonstrates superior heat tolerance compared to plastic or natural fiber alternatives, maintaining its structural integrity and performance characteristics even when subjected to temperatures exceeding 200°C during styling sessions.

The thermal stability of stainless steel prevents warping, melting, or degradation that commonly affects plastic brush components when exposed to heat. This resistance allows users to employ heat styling techniques without concern for damaging their brush, extending the tool's functional lifespan while maintaining consistent performance standards throughout its use.

Chemical Resistance Properties

Hair care products, including shampoos, conditioners, styling gels, and chemical treatments, can be harsh on brush materials over time. The chemical resistance of stainless steel makes it an ideal choice for hair brushes that will be exposed to various cosmetic formulations. Unlike plastic materials that may absorb chemicals or wooden components that can be damaged by alkaline products, stainless steel remains inert and unaffected by most hair care formulations.

This chemical inertness means that a stainless steel straight hair brush can be thoroughly cleaned with various sanitizing agents without risk of material degradation. Professional salons particularly benefit from this property, as they require tools that can withstand regular sterilization procedures while maintaining their structural integrity.

Surface Treatment and Finishing

Professional-grade stainless steel straight hair brushes often receive specialized surface treatments that further enhance their durability and performance characteristics. Electropolishing processes remove microscopic surface imperfections and create an ultra-smooth finish that resists bacterial adhesion and simplifies cleaning procedures. This smooth surface also reduces friction during styling, minimizing wear on both the brush and the user's hair.

The finishing processes applied to stainless steel hair brushes can include passivation treatments that enhance the natural oxide layer, providing additional corrosion resistance and extending the tool's service life. These treatments ensure that the brush maintains its appearance and functionality even after years of regular professional or personal use.

Comparative Analysis with Alternative Materials

Plastic and Synthetic Material Comparison

When comparing the durability of stainless steel straight hair brushes to plastic alternatives, the differences become immediately apparent in both laboratory testing and real-world applications. Plastic brushes are susceptible to stress cracking, particularly at bristle attachment points, and can become brittle over time due to UV exposure and repeated temperature cycling.

The flexibility limitations of plastic materials mean that plastic brushes must be designed with thicker components to achieve adequate strength, resulting in bulkier tools that may be less precise in their styling capabilities. In contrast, the superior material properties of stainless steel allow for more refined designs without compromising durability, providing users with tools that are both elegant and long-lasting.

Natural Material Performance

Traditional hair brushes made from natural materials such as wood or natural bristles, while offering certain aesthetic and tactile benefits, cannot match the durability characteristics of a stainless steel straight hair brush. Wooden components are subject to expansion and contraction with humidity changes, potentially causing loosening of bristles or structural distortion over time.

Natural bristles, while gentle on hair, have limited lifespans and can become contaminated with bacteria or fungi if not properly maintained. The hygienic advantages and maintenance simplicity of stainless steel make it a superior choice for users prioritizing long-term performance and cleanliness in their hair care tools.
